Output 58e644d3d5395c64e2f7912f0348cd1b8b5815204911c40e78d6ea68634e3be7:0

value
2458428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2c58e329e5efbb5e218b45adb5ae50c2ac5c131 OP_EQUAL
address
3KSsg9pS2st3o5kPbdvUh46mK33L2ukRDj
transaction
58e644d3d5395c64e2f7912f0348cd1b8b5815204911c40e78d6ea68634e3be7
spent
true